Let Natural Light Define the Space

Spring interiors are known for their bright and airy feel, and natural light plays a central role in creating that effect. Window blinds allow homeowners to manage daylight while keeping interiors open and comfortable.

Light-filtering blinds, such as roller blinds or sheer-dimout blinds, allow sunlight to enter gently without causing glare. Instead of blocking light completely, these blinds diffuse it, spreading brightness evenly across the room. This creates interiors that feel fresh and welcoming while maintaining privacy.

For spaces that require more flexibility, motorised blinds make it easy to adjust light levels throughout the day. With simple controls, sunlight can be managed effortlessly as it changes from morning to evening.

Warm Foundations with Wooden Flooring

Flooring is another element that contributes to the bright, natural feel associated with spring interiors. Wooden flooring reflects light softly and adds warmth underfoot, helping rooms feel balanced and comfortable.

Light and medium wood tones are particularly effective in creating a fresh atmosphere. They complement natural light and help interiors feel more open, especially in spaces with large windows. Chevron and classic flooring layouts also add subtle visual movement that enhances the sense of openness.

Creating Seamless Indoor – Outdoor Living

Spring is also the season when outdoor spaces become more inviting. Balconies, patios, and sit-outs begin to feel like natural extensions of indoor living areas. Shade solutions such as awnings and outdoor umbrellas help make these spaces comfortable throughout the day.

By filtering direct sunlight, awnings reduce heat near windows and allow balconies to remain pleasant even during brighter afternoons. This connection between indoor comfort and outdoor relaxation strengthens the overall feeling of freshness that spring brings.
